Course overview
The Summer School, which will last for 5 days, will be taught in English. It awards 6 University educational credits (CFU) and has as its learning outcome : refinement of methodological and writing skills, peer-to-peer discussion, and acquisition of expert knowledge in the arena of rural development studies.

Selection criteria
Admission to the Summer School is subject to passing the selection procedure : the evaluation of the study titles, research project and draft paper submitted by the candidate on the deadline of the application procedure.
The maximum score awarded by the Examination Committee is 100 points. 40 points will be awarded based on the study titles and the other 60 points will be awarded based on the research project and draft paper
The minimum score of 80/100 must be achieved to pass the selection.
The selection procedure will take place at online during an internal committe meeting of the School's board on 14 March 2025 between 9.30 and 11.00AM.
Admission to the Programme is granted to eligible applicants, within the limits of available places, based on the ranking list prepared in accordance with the total score awarded.
In the event of two applicants with the same score, the applicant who obtained the better grade in the evaluation of the research paper will rank higher. If the grade is the same, the younger applicant will rank higher.
